‘Get a life Roy’ – former Liverpool defender hits out at Keane

Former Liverpool defender Phil Thompson has waded into the row between Virgil van Dijk and Roy Keane, telling the latter to “get a life”.

Van Dijk, speaking after the drab 0-0 draw between Liverpool and Manchester United on Sunday, said “only one team tried to win the game” and that “Liverpool were superior in all aspects”, prompting a rant from Keane on Sky Sports in which he accused the Netherlands defender of being arrogant.

Van Dijk dismissed Keane’s jibe and Thompson also threw his support behind the Liverpool captain.

He told talkSPORT: “It wasn’t arrogant by any means. I would say it was more frustration.

“I really feel as though, you’ve come off that game, you know you’ve dominated, Manchester United have had that one chance with [Rasmus] Hojlund, and you’ve just felt frustration. Arrogance wasn’t in it.

“And for Roy Keane to be talking about arrogance in people…come on, do me a favour.

“And I love Roy but I played that back and he just kept repeating the word. Roy, just get a life.”

The draw, in which Liverpool had 34 shots compared to United’s six, saw the Merseysiders slip to second in the Premier League table, behind Arsenal.
